Vijay Khandal

Software Engineer

New York, New York, United States9 yrs 9 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Expert in Java and Spring Framework development.
  • Proven track record in microservices architecture.
  • Strong experience in payment systems integration.
Stackforce AI infers this person is a Backend-heavy Fullstack Engineer with expertise in Fintech solutions.

Contact

Skills

Core Skills

JavaSpring FrameworkCloud AuthenticationMicroservicesMicroservices ArchitectureCache AuthenticationRouting Protocol

Other Skills

AerospikeAndroidAndroid DevelopmentBack-End Web DevelopmentCC++Data StructuresDistributed TracingDockerElastic SearchElasticSearchEurekaFront-end DevelopmentHTMLHibernate

About

Experienced Software Engineer with a demonstrated history of working in the computer software industry. Skilled in Java, Spring Framework, Hibernate, Elastic Search,Python, Php, Docker, Symfony Framework, Redis, Aerospike, RabbitMQ, Mysql, Node.js, MongoDB, Android Development . Strong engineering professional with a Bachelor’s Degree focused in Computer Science from NIT Raipur.

Experience

Amazon

2 roles

Software Developer

Feb 2022Present · 4 yrs 1 mo

  • Developed advertising global payment registration and execution infrastructure.
  • Developed cross country payments accessible for advertisers.
  • Developed DaaS (Disbursement as a Service) for the amazon vendors payout.
  • Developed BaaS (Billing as a Service) payment registration and execution capabilities.
JavaSpring FrameworkHibernateElastic SearchDocker

Software Developer

Aug 2019Feb 2022 · 2 yrs 6 mos

  • Integrate cloud authentication system to migrate from old system to new system without security flaws.
  • Optimise system latencies by re-architect existing components.
Cloud AuthenticationSystem Optimization

Rivigo

Software Developer

Mar 2019Aug 2019 · 5 mos · Gurgaon, India

  • Integrate distributed tracing logging solution in all microservices to reduce production bug debugging time.
  • Developed authentication for internal microservices interaction which make our system more secure.
  • Developed reconcilation system in which we are verfiying transactions happens daily and then raise concern to finance team in case of any inconsistency.
  • Integrated with third party payment systems (like axis bank) for payment transfer.
  • Developed mock server which is responsible to provide mocked response after third party stops their support on dev and staging environment.
MicroservicesDistributed TracingPayment Systems

Airtel x labs

Senior Software Developer

Feb 2018Mar 2019 · 1 yr 1 mo · Gurgaon, India

  • Develop coupon engine which is used to distribute coupons to milions of users and handle their coupon journey.
  • Setup service discovery server and api gateway to support micro services architecture.
  • Develop distributed system which is used to unlock or distribute cashback to the user on the basis of their imei's.
  • Setup hystrix on production server to handle critical services failure and enhance user app experience.
  • Integrate third party payment mode with enable/disable controlled configuration.
  • Design solution to move standalone redis server to redis cluster setup.
Microservices ArchitectureService DiscoveryRedis

Naukri.com

Senior Software Developer

Jun 2016Feb 2018 · 1 yr 8 mos · Noida

  • Key Accomplishments :-
  • Developed Cache based authentication that can handle huge amount of web requests.
  • Developed Google and Facebook login and signup for better user experience on site.
  • Developed trigger based rabbitmq based debugger through which we can debug live user flow without touching product code.
  • Developed a library called MOCKER which provide easier and central interface to use mocking in testcases.
  • Developed Config based Rest API architecture which contains all dependencies require to resolve an rest api request.
  • Develope an chrome extension to make checkout page testing phase faster.
  • Setup jenkins jobs to get notification for active git branches conflicts with master.
  • Setup stubbed server to increase ui developement speed and reduce service dependency.
  • Write acceptance and integration test in scala for bugless feature delivery.
Cache AuthenticationRabbitMQREST API

University of duesseldorf

Research Internship

May 2015Jun 2015 · 1 mo · germany

  • Develop a ODMRP(On demand multihop routing protocol) protocol for MANET (mobile ad-hoc network). This routing strategy is tested over group of raspberry pi's. Raspberry pi is used to create hops in the network.
Routing ProtocolMobile Ad-hoc Network

Education

National Institute of Technology Raipur

Bachelor’s Degree — Computer Science

Jan 2012Jan 2016

Stackforce found 100+ more professionals with Java & Spring Framework

Explore similar profiles based on matching skills and experience